**Handover: formula sandboxing in Gridlewood**

Ruta —

State of things: user-supplied formulas now run inside the `cellcage` interpreter. No filesystem, no network, 50ms CPU cap, 4MB memory cap. Plugin authors can register custom functions, but only through the allowlist API — direct eval hooks were removed in v3. Known gaps: recursion depth isn't enforced yet (ticket open), and error messages leak internal type names. Don't relax the caps without a security review. Sandbox spec and the allowlist request process are on the internal page.

dashboard of bahaf-tageg = https://jira.zemvarlabs.internal/projects/projects/browse/projects

Hello plugin authors,

Next Thursday we are running a disaster-recovery drill for the SlimCrate container-slimming pipeline. During the drill, the registry at our Varnholt site will be failed over, and plugin build hooks will temporarily reject uploads. Please ensure your layer-pruning plugins handle retry responses gracefully. To re-register your plugin against the standby registry, open the recovery console and authenticate when prompted. Use the passphrase provided immediately below this message.

recovery phrase for fajeg-hagug: holox-fenmir

## TideBoard Widget Restart

If the tide-table widget on the Harborlight dashboard stops refreshing, restart the fetcher pod in the coastal-data namespace first. It pulls predictions from the internal Moonpull service every fifteen minutes. After the pod is healthy, verify one successful fetch in the logs before closing the incident. The fetcher authenticates to Moonpull with the key below.

app token of fahaf-yafof = kto2_sf

## Configuration

We finally killed the homegrown queue (RIP Shoveler) and moved everything to Quillbus. On-call: if jobs stall, it's almost always auth to the broker, not the workers. Quillbus reads its config from the service .env at boot. Make sure that file includes the following line:

vault entry, yahaf-tagug: LEDGER_TOKEN20=884d77d1a8b98aa4edfb